freiberufler Embedded Linux und Automatisierung auf freelance.de

Embedded Linux und Automatisierung

offline
  • auf Anfrage
  • Ulm
  • auf Anfrage
  • de  |  sr  |  en
  • 02.06.2022

Kurzvorstellung

Linux Spezialist mit jahrelanger Erfahrung im Bereich Embedded Systeme, Software Engineering, Automotiv, Medizintechnik, Testautomatisierung, SPS

Qualifikationen

  • Automatisierungstechnik (allg.)4 J.
  • Embedded Linux9 J.
  • Embedded Systems8 J.
  • Forschung & Entwicklung10 J.
  • HIL
  • IT Sicherheit (allg.)8 J.
  • Kommunikation (allg.)8 J.
  • Linux Entwicklung8 J.
  • Linux (Kernel)16 J.
  • Rechnergestütztes Betriebsleitsystem (RBL)15 J.
  • Remote-Service11 J.
  • Vertrieb (allg.)8 J.

Projekt‐ & Berufserfahrung

SPS mit CoDeSys CANopen und EtherCat Förderbänder und Sortieranlagen
Kundenname anonymisiert, Gundelfingen
4/2020 – offen (4 Jahre, 8 Monate)
Maschinen-, Geräte- und Komponentenbau
Tätigkeitszeitraum

4/2020 – offen

Tätigkeitsbeschreibung

• Target und Web Visualisierung mit Touchdisplay
• Frequenzumrichter Einstellung über CANopen
• Digital/Analog über EtherCat
• CANalyzer und Busmaster
• Linearmotor und EM-239 Treiber
• Aufbau von VPN und Firewall für die SPS Geräte
• LTE Router mit WLAN und GPS
• Fernwartung und update
• ModbusTCP, MQTT

Eingesetzte Qualifikationen

Automatisierungstechnik (allg.)

System/Software Entwickler Embedded
Leica, Nussloch
11/2019 – 1/2020 (3 Monate)
Life Sciences
Tätigkeitszeitraum

11/2019 – 1/2020

Tätigkeitsbeschreibung

System/Software Entwickler Embedded
Medizingerät für Gewebe Messung
• Embedded Linux mit ARM Architektur für Medizingeräte
• CAN FD, Ethernet, Audio, framebuffer Touch+Display
• YOCTO, Bash, Python und Treiber Programmierung
• Linux Kernel Anpassung und Testaufbau mit Python

Eingesetzte Qualifikationen

Embedded Linux, Linux (Kernel)

System/Software Integration und Testautomatisierung Park-Assistent und PVS für P
Magna Electronics Europe GmbH & Co OHG, Goldbach
10/2019 – 3/2020 (6 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2019 – 3/2020

Tätigkeitsbeschreibung

• ECU Tests automatisieren mit VTESTStudio
• Build AUTOSAR und QNX mit CMake
• CANo DiVA und CANdelaStudio
• ECU flashing mit DediProg
• Vollautomatisierung von Smoke und Qualification Tests
◦ JENKINS, PTC, CANoe, Python, Bilder aufnehmen
◦ vTestStudio, Batch, CAPL mit DLL‘s Anbindung

Eingesetzte Qualifikationen

Test Automation

System/Software Integration und Testautomatisierung Park-Assistent und PVS für P
Magna Electronics Europe GmbH & Co OHG, Goldbach
10/2019 – 3/2020 (6 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2019 – 3/2020

Tätigkeitsbeschreibung

• ECU Tests automatisieren mit VTESTStudio
• Build AUTOSAR und QNX mit CMake
• CANo DiVA und CANdelaStudio
• ECU flashing mit DediProg
• Vollautomatisierung von Smoke und Qualification Tests
◦ JENKINS, PTC, CANoe, Python, Bilder aufnehmen
◦ vTestStudio, Batch, CAPL mit DLL‘s Anbindung

Eingesetzte Qualifikationen

Test Automation

System/Software Integration und Testautomatisierung Park-Assistent und PVS für P
Magna Electronics Europe GmbH & Co OHG, Goldbach
10/2019 – 3/2020 (6 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2019 – 3/2020

Tätigkeitsbeschreibung

• ECU Tests automatisieren mit VTESTStudio
• Build AUTOSAR und QNX mit CMake
• CANo DiVA und CANdelaStudio
• ECU flashing mit DediProg
• Vollautomatisierung von Smoke und Qualification Tests
◦ JENKINS, PTC, CANoe, Python, Bilder aufnehmen
◦ vTestStudio, Batch, CAPL mit DLL‘s Anbindung

Eingesetzte Qualifikationen

Test Automation

System/Software Integration und Testautomatisierung
Magna Electronics, Goldbach
10/2019 – 3/2020 (6 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2019 – 3/2020

Tätigkeitsbeschreibung

System/Software Integration und Testautomatisierung
Park-Assistent und PVS
• Tests automatisieren mit VTESTStudio
• Build AUTOSAR und QNX mit CMake
• CANo DiVA und CANdelaStudio
• DediProg

Eingesetzte Qualifikationen

Test Automation, Canoe Software

System/Software Integration und Testautomatisierung
Magna Automotiv Services, Sailauf
10/2018 – 4/2019 (7 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2018 – 4/2019

Tätigkeitsbeschreibung

• JENKINS
• Python, Batch
• Test Spezifikationen prüfen/schreiben
• QAC, QACPP
• CANoe, Setup von CAN FD und Vector Hardware
• Kamera, Radar und LiDAR Sensoren
• Basic Test automatisieren für mehrere OEM‘s

Eingesetzte Qualifikationen

Linux (Kernel), Jenkins, Python, Radar

System/Software Entwickler Embedded
Becker Mining Systems AG, Saarbrücken
6/2018 – 9/2018 (4 Monate)
Bergbau
Tätigkeitszeitraum

6/2018 – 9/2018

Tätigkeitsbeschreibung

• Xilinx zynq 7000, Ethernet und DMA Treiber
• Entwicklung von Embedded Linux System für kollisionsschutz
• Setup von WiFi, Bluetooth, CAN, RS485 und I2C
• ARM Cortex M7, YOCTO
• Radar, UHF und Elektromagnetischer Sensor
• Python, C und Bash

Eingesetzte Qualifikationen

Linux (Kernel), Python, Radar

Senior System/Software Entwickler Security
Rohde und Schwarz, Bochum/Saarbrücken
11/2017 – 5/2018 (7 Monate)
High-Tech- und Elektroindustrie
Tätigkeitszeitraum

11/2017 – 5/2018

Tätigkeitsbeschreibung

Senior System/Software Entwickler Security
- Entwicklung von Embedded Linux Distribution für spezielle Server
- Trusted Computing
- TPM -> Trusted Plattform Module
- VirtuelBox, Qemu KVM -> Virtual Machine
- Continuous Integretion (JENKINS)

Eingesetzte Qualifikationen

Cyber Security

Konzept für eine HIL und Aufbau der Test Automatisierung Test Konzept für eine E
TRW, Radolfzell/Ulm
10/2016 – 9/2017 (1 Jahr)
Automobilindustrie
Tätigkeitszeitraum

10/2016 – 9/2017

Tätigkeitsbeschreibung

- Planung und Erstellung von Testfällen
- Continuous Integration (JENKINS)
- Konzept für automatisches Testen
- Automatisierung der Tests mit Python, CAPL
- CANoe Software

Eingesetzte Qualifikationen

Testen, Jenkins, Python, CAN-Bus (controller area network)

CEO
Bonira GmbH Embedded Systems, Ulm
3/2016 – offen (8 Jahre, 9 Monate)
Dienstleistungsbranche
Tätigkeitszeitraum

3/2016 – offen

Tätigkeitsbeschreibung

Gründung und Leitung der Firma
Bonira GmbH Embedded Systems, Ulm (Germany)
Die Firma Bonira GmbH ist tätig im Bereich embedded Linux Entwicklung.
Es werden eigene Linux Distributionen entwickelt welche sich hauptsächlich auf low power und embedded Sicherheit konzentrieren. Die Linux Distributionen werden Geräte steuern als Kommunikation Schnittstelle für Fernwartung und Ferndiagnose.

Eingesetzte Qualifikationen

Embedded Linux, Embedded Systems, IT Sicherheit (allg.), Linux (Kernel), Linux Entwicklung, Rechnergestütztes Betriebsleitsystem (RBL), Remote-Service, Vertrieb (allg.), Kommunikation (allg.), Forschung & Entwicklung

Build and Release Management Fahrerassistenzsysteme
Continental, Lindau
11/2015 – 9/2016 (11 Monate)
Automobilindustrie
Tätigkeitszeitraum

11/2015 – 9/2016

Tätigkeitsbeschreibung

Planung und Erstellung von Software Release mit IMS/MKS
Continuous Integration (JENKINS)
Konzept für automatisches Release Management
Automatisierung der Software Produktion mit Python

Eingesetzte Qualifikationen

Release-Management, Python, Management (allg.)

Systemarchitekt und Software Engineering
E.ON Connecting Energies GmbH, Essen
3/2015 – 12/2015 (10 Monate)
Versorgungswirtschaft
Tätigkeitszeitraum

3/2015 – 12/2015

Tätigkeitsbeschreibung

Systemarchitekt und Software Engineering für virtuelle Kraftwerke

- Erstellen von Linux Distribution
- Konzept für Monitoring und Steuerung der Anlage (SCADA)
- Implementierung der Software für für Steuerung und Monitoring
- Konzept für Systemtests (testen der Hardware und Software)
- ufbau von Test-Lines
- Treiber für MODBUS und GSM Modulen

Eingesetzte Qualifikationen

Hardware-Design, Linux (Kernel), Software engineering / -technik, System Architektur, GSM/GPRS, SCADA, Bioenergietechnik, Technische Konzeption

Embedded Entwickler
Hirschmann Car Communication, Neckartenzlingen
10/2014 – 2/2015 (5 Monate)
Automobilindustrie
Tätigkeitszeitraum

10/2014 – 2/2015

Tätigkeitsbeschreibung

Embedded Linux, RTOS, MOST, IPC, JTAG Lauterbach, Audio/Video Programmierung
Systemarchitekt, Infotainment, Multimedia

Eingesetzte Qualifikationen

Embedded Entwicklung / hardwarenahe Entwicklung, Embedded Linux, Linux (Kernel), Echtzeit-Betriebssysteme, System Architektur, MOST-Bus (media oriented systems transport)

Scrum Master
Daimler, Böblingen
1/2014 – 12/2014 (1 Jahr)
Automobilindustrie
Tätigkeitszeitraum

1/2014 – 12/2014

Tätigkeitsbeschreibung

SCRUM-Master und Projektdurchführung bei
Daimler AG, Böblingen.
Konzepterstellung, IT-Feinspezifikation und
Implementierung eines Software Moduls für Flashware.
Machbarkeitsstudie und neue Konzepte im Telematik
und Flashware Bereich.

Eingesetzte Qualifikationen

Scrum

Projektleiter
Bonira do.o., Banja Luka
7/2013 – 1/2016 (2 Jahre, 7 Monate)
Dienstleistungsbranche
Tätigkeitszeitraum

7/2013 – 1/2016

Tätigkeitsbeschreibung

Modernisierung alter Windkraftanlagen mit Fernwartung
und Ferndiagnose.
• Realisierung von SCADA für Windkraftanlagen
• SPS programmiert mit CoDesys (ST)
• Web Visualisierung des Prozesses
• Steuerung über Touch+Display
• Fernwartung und Ferndiagnose über GSM Router
• Kontrolle und Diagnose über Android Apps

Eingesetzte Qualifikationen

Android, Projektleitung / Teamleitung (IT), Android Entwicklung, Router / Gateways, Router, GSM/GPRS, SCADA, Codesys, Windkraft, Remote-Service, Windkraftanlagenbau, Speicherprogrammierbare Steuerung (SPS), Projektleitung / Teamleitung, Sanctioned Party Screening (SPS)

Technischer Projektleiter
NSN, Ulm
7/2011 – 6/2013 (2 Jahre)
Telekommunikation
Tätigkeitszeitraum

7/2011 – 6/2013

Tätigkeitsbeschreibung

Verantwortlich für einen zu betreuenden Bereich von ca.
25 Ingenieuren weltweit.
Letztes erfolgreiches Projekt war die Entwicklung von 3G
und LTE auf einer Hardware (dual-mode Antennen) für
japanischen Markt.
• Machbarkeitsstudie (Multi core Konzepte)
Real-time ↔ non Real-Time auf einem SoC
• toolchain für MIPS Architektur
• Bring up und testen der Hardware
• Portierung von u-boot, Linux und Treiber von
verschiedenen FPGA´s und ASIC´s
• Root file system und System start- up
• HAL → Hardwareabstraktionsschicht
• CI Aufbau mit Jenkins
• I&V - Feature und Testplanung

Eingesetzte Qualifikationen

Hardware-Design, Linux (Kernel), Projektleitung / Teamleitung (IT), Systemmigration, LTE (Telekommunikation), Architektur (allg.), Rechnergestütztes Betriebsleitsystem (RBL), Technische Projektleitung / Teamleitung, Technisches Testing, Technisches Testdesign, Technische Konzeption, Projektleitung / Teamleitung, Forschung & Entwicklung

Software Entwickler
Sysgo AG, Ulm
11/2006 – 6/2011 (4 Jahre, 8 Monate)
High-Tech- und Elektroindustrie
Tätigkeitszeitraum

11/2006 – 6/2011

Tätigkeitsbeschreibung

• BSP's mit Linux und u-boot auf verschiedenen
Plattformen
• ARM, POWERPC, MIPS 32/64 bit
• Networking
• Treiber für Marvell und Broadcom Chip´s
• Ethernet, SRIO, HDLC, TCP/UDP/SCTP
• network performance test
• CI Aufbau mit Hudson
• Aufbau von Tests und Planung von Test Szenarien
• Root file system und start-up der Systeme
• Toolchain Aufbau für ARM, MIPS und POWERPC
• Linux Treiber für verschiedene ASIC's

Eingesetzte Qualifikationen

Linux (Kernel), Betriebssysteme, ARM-Architektur, Softwareentwicklung (allg.), TCP / IP, Telekommunikation / Netzwerke (allg.), Ethernet, HDLC (High-Level Data Link Control), Rechnergestütztes Betriebsleitsystem (RBL)

Ausbildung

Elektrotechnik
Dipl.-Ing. (FH) Elektrotechnik
2006
Hagen NRW
Energieelektroniker (Betriebstechnik)
Ausbildung
2001
Iserlohn

Weitere Kenntnisse

Betriebssysteme: Linux, Windows, VxWorks
Programme: MS Office, open Office, verschieden CMS's,
freemind, WebEx, Visio, ClearCase,
Subversion, CVS, Git, Gimp, mySQL,
Wireshark, nmap, SCADA, CoDeSys
Programmiersprachen: C/C++, Assembler,
Skriptsprachen: Python, TCL/TK, PHP

Persönliche Daten

Sprache
  • Deutsch (Muttersprache)
  • Englisch (Gut)
  • Serbisch (Fließend)
Reisebereitschaft
auf Anfrage
Arbeitserlaubnis
  • Europäische Union
Home-Office
bevorzugt
Profilaufrufe
7344
Berufserfahrung
18 Jahre (seit 11/2006)
Projektleitung
3 Jahre

Kontaktdaten

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.

Jetzt Mitglied werden